phpMyAdmin
 sql >> Base de données >  >> Database Tools >> phpMyAdmin

#1146 - La table 'phpmyadmin.pma__tracking' n'existe pas comment la désactiver manuellement ?

Je viens de tester cela avec le phpMyAdmin que j'ai installé et même lorsque j'ai supprimé la table manuellement et que j'ai reçu le message d'erreur, j'ai pu l'effacer en me déconnectant et en me reconnectant. Ma première suggestion est donc de vous assurer que votre phpMyAdmin est plutôt à jour, car cette fonctionnalité a reçu quelques améliorations dans les versions récentes.

Ensuite, je vous suggère de vous déconnecter, de vider le cache de votre navigateur (au moins en ce qui concerne la page phpMyAdmin) et de vous reconnecter.

Vous pouvez soit corriger le tableau, soit désactiver cette fonctionnalité.

Réparer le le stockage de configuration de phpMyAdmin

Exécutez simplement le create_tables.sql fichier inclus dans les examples ou sql dossier de votre installation phpMyAdmin. Vous devez modifier le fichier si vous souhaitez utiliser un nom de base de données ou des noms de table autres que ceux par défaut.

Cela pourrait être plus difficile si, pour une raison quelconque, votre phpMyAdmin ne vous permet toujours pas de vous connecter. Dans ce cas, vous pouvez soit le faire depuis le mysql client de ligne de commande ou désactivez la fonctionnalité (voir ci-dessous) afin d'y accéder. Cela ne devrait pas être nécessaire, cependant; phpMyAdmin devrait automatiquement désactiver la fonctionnalité lors de la connexion si la table est manquante.

Modifiez ensuite config.inc.php et assurez-vous que les valeurs attribuées à chaque table correspondent aux noms de table que vous venez de créer. Voir http://docs.phpmyadmin.net/en/latest/config. html#cfg_Servers_pmadb pour la liste si vous avez des questions sur les valeurs par défaut.

Désactivation pure et simple de la fonctionnalité

Modifiez simplement config.inc.php et supprimez la ligne $cfg['Servers'][$i]['tracking'] . Cela désactivera entièrement la fonctionnalité afin que phpMyAdmin ne recherche pas le tableau de suivi.